Which of these is the most basic oxide?

Option: 1

FeO


Option: 2

CuO


Option: 3

SnO2


Option: 4

K2O

Chemical Properties of Elements -

Nature of Oxides

 

When the oxygen atom combines with any other atom and forms a compound, then it is known as as oxide. In moving from left to right in a period, the nature of oxide changes from basic to acidic while in moving down the group, the basic nature of oxides increases and acidic nature decreases. The oxides of metals are basic in nature, oxides of non-metals are acidic in nature and oxides of metalloids are amphoteric in nature.

If an element forms a number of oxides, then acidic nature of oxides increases with the increase oxygen atoms.

Alkali metal oxide (K2O) is most basic in nature. While going left to right in periods the basic nature decreases. K is in the first group most left in the periodic table, so K2O will be the most basic oxide among these.

Therefore, Option(4) is correct
